The Narrows is a splendid spot to spend some time at, and hey, Gotta ski right? Living Memorial Park is a delightful location to do that. At Power Canal Reservoir during the days of summer highs  
   are in the 70's with nighttime lows in the 50's. For the duration of the winter highs are typically in the 20's, and winter nights come with lows in the 0's to Power Canal Reservoir.

Power Canal Reservoir regularly gets a large amount of rain; during the month of November you get the most rain around here, and the driest month is February.
